Output bd34ba145b4cb002fc7a9ac27d013daf622d40ee81f1bfc058897a938deafef4:0

value
823260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d85dccf13e05e5e4701c8d0a2ec5467048a4292e OP_EQUAL
address
3MR4FMbtseDVsXFqLwVGUYf7wKsczLgQoE
transaction
bd34ba145b4cb002fc7a9ac27d013daf622d40ee81f1bfc058897a938deafef4
spent
true